Transaction 021c2299b5c0de68dd580afc2c7bc0140e04e79c2bd714c448e438eb442f3b37

1 Input
1 Outputs
  • 021c2299b5c0de68dd580afc2c7bc0140e04e79c2bd714c448e438eb442f3b37:0
  • value  578890
    address  3PUowtu9xwqrWHsb95SbG4vCJCSj1Cccn6